Components of Lifestyle:
* Habits: Your regular routines and activities, like eating habits, exercise routines, sleep patterns, and daily work/study schedules.
* Values: Your beliefs and principles that guide your choices and actions.
* Interests: The things you enjoy doing in your free time, such as hobbies, sports, arts, or social activities.
* Consumption: The products and services you choose to purchase and use, from food and clothing to electronics and entertainment.
* Social Connections: The people you spend your time with, your family, friends, and community.
* Environment: The physical surroundings you live in, including your home, neighborhood, and city.
Influences on Lifestyle:
* Culture: Your cultural background, traditions, and norms.
* Socioeconomic status: Your income, education level, and social position.
* Personal values and goals: Your aspirations, motivations, and priorities.
* Life stage: Your age, family situation, and career stage.
Examples of Lifestyles:
* Minimalist lifestyle: Focusing on simplicity, owning fewer possessions, and prioritizing experiences over material items.
* Healthy lifestyle: Emphasizing healthy eating, regular exercise, and stress management.
* Sustainable lifestyle: Making conscious choices to reduce environmental impact.
* Travel lifestyle: Prioritizing exploration, adventure, and experiencing different cultures.
Significance of Lifestyle:
* Personal well-being: A lifestyle aligned with your values can promote happiness, satisfaction, and a sense of purpose.
* Health and longevity: Healthy lifestyle choices can contribute to physical and mental well-being.
* Social impact: Our lifestyle choices can impact the environment, communities, and future generations.
* Self-expression: Lifestyle provides a platform for expressing individuality, creativity, and passions.
Ultimately, your lifestyle is a reflection of who you are and what you want to achieve in life. It's a constantly evolving process of making choices and shaping your experiences.
